Intel® Core™ Processor i9-9900 Processor is 9th generation because the number 9 is listed after i9. Here are some examples: Intel® Core™ Processor i7-10710U Processor is 10th generation because the number 10 is listed after i7. The generation of the processor is the first number after i9, i7, i5, or i3. How do I know the processor of my processor? It displays the Graphics information, Chipset information, Technologies supported by the processor, and more. The Intel® Processor Identification Utility is free software that can identify the specifications of your processor. What is Intel Processor Identification Utility?
